How Energy Storage Chargers Work (No PhD Required)
Let’s break it down without the technobabble:
- The Basics: These chargers store electricity (from solar panels, the grid, or even your morning toast-making session) in high-capacity batteries.
- The Magic Trick: They release that stored energy to charge your EV even when the grid’s taking a nap—like during storms or rolling blackouts.
- Bonus Points: Some models can power your home during outages. Talk about multitasking!

The Cool Tech You’ll Want to Brag About at Parties
1. Vehicle-to-Grid (V2G) Systems
Your car battery becomes a mini power plant. Parked at work? Sell stored energy back to the grid. It’s like Uber, but for electricity.
2. Supercapacitors: The Speed Demons
These badgers charge faster than you can say “range anxiety” (seriously—0 to 80% in under 5 minutes). Perfect for taxi fleets and impatient humans.
3. Hydrogen Hybrids
Combine hydrogen fuel cells with batteries, and suddenly your charger works in -40°F weather. Take that, Tesla!
